Fiesta Beats the Fit on CarDomain

By Rob Einaudi

Editor-in-Chief

I was expecting Honda to win this one, but the feisty Fiesta upstaged the Fit for a convincing win in this week’s Showroom Showdown. Think the Fiesta will be hit with the tuner crowd?
